Output b06891233f8d82791c9d5f76a45a2839053525bda0b9295fc86b55bf2927af5e:1

value
2622113694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21597b78f5e241b388c28a9f26ad60c271511d7c OP_EQUAL
address
34jMRDPNahFSSGkGkmCpN9fKWXdAi8qvuc
transaction
b06891233f8d82791c9d5f76a45a2839053525bda0b9295fc86b55bf2927af5e
confirmations
348958
spent
true